Creating a feasibility study is an iterative process. We move through research, a long list, and a short list, before a detailed report. At each stage we review options with you.
Feasibility studies start with what you want to achieve. We create a list of building services criteria important to you. These can include:
As part of this, we’ll discuss your priorities, so we understand your must-haves and things you’re prepared to compromise on.
If you’ve lots of decision makers involved in your project, we recommend workshops to understand all your requirements, so we only suggest options that will work for you.
We research building service systems and create a long list of options that may meet your needs.
We present the long list, summarise pros and cons of each option and identify those we think best fit your goals. Together we agree a short list to investigate in more detail.
We produce a report that details the pros and cons of each option and identifies the best fit from the short list. If none are perfect, we’ll identify the ones closest to meeting all of your requirements.
This report helps you make an informed decision on which building services solutions are best for you. We can make recommendations, or simply outline the aspects of each option so you can choose.
The next stage after a feasibility study is concept design. A feasibility study narrows your options to two or three to study in a concept, which will help you make a final decision on which option best suits your needs.
